Cause of knocking sound?
well my engine at idle has a huge knocking sound... wondering what could have caused this... its a r18 and here are the mods
Injen CAI Apex'i N1 muffler and things i recently took off Apex'i VAFC II Greddy e-manage ultimate... |

Hmm. The only way I can think of that the ECU could cause an engine knock would be if it was advancing the timing too far and causing detonation. If this happened the knock sensor should simply correct for it.
Did the noise start right after you removed the mods? What circuits/sensors were the piggybacks connected to? Has anything else changed recently? |
